Q: My gifs aren’t moving when I upload them on Tumblr! Help?
A: Remember that any gifs you want to upload here, must have less than 1MB and can’t be wider than 500px. Try to delete some frames or change the size of the gif. You can also try to make your gif just in black & white! Less colours = “lighter” gif.

Q: How do you download videos from YouTube?
A: I use a Chrome extension - Ultimate YouTube Downloader. I usually download the high quality .mp4 files. If I want to make a very big gif (like 500x500 or 500x600), I try to download the HD version.
